- ➤ Iowa Homeless Youth Centers hosts Reggie’s Sleepout today at Drake Stadium to raise funds for homeless youth services—an event started nearly 20 years ago in honor of Reggie Kelsey, a Des Moines teen who died after aging out of foster care. Organizers say the night outdoors will help people understand the challenges of not having a stable home. KCCI

- ➤ Instacart data shows that Iowans chose Peanut M&M’s as their favorite Halloween candy with Oct 31 orders doubling the average and overall October purchases 20.8% above the national rate. While Reese’s Peanut Butter Cups topped the national list and candy corn orders rose 73% above normal, Peanut M&M’s remained the top pick—confirming its statewide popularity. The Des Moines Register

- ➤ Des Moines Area Community College announced that Liang Chee Wee will serve as interim president from January through June, 2026 following President Rob Denson's retirement. He previously led Northeast Iowa Community College and Eastern Iowa Community Colleges — while the board continues its search for a permanent president set to begin in July. The Des Moines Register

- ➤ Iowa residents will face higher health insurance premiums for 2026 as six insurers raise rates by 12.5% to over 25% when enhanced tax credits lapse today—causing monthly costs to rise by $64 to $157 for thousands. The changes come as healthier enrollees are expected to leave the market, leaving a sicker, costlier pool for insurers. The Des Moines Register
- ➤ Iowa HHS is starting a competitive process today to award up to $1 million per project from opioid settlement funds aimed at expanding treatment, prevention, and recovery services—each round offering $7 million for community initiatives. The grants follow a law signed by Gov. Reynolds in June directing 75% of settlement money to fight opioid misuse. The Des Moines Register
